  Job Description Summary: The Massachusetts Department of Agricultural Resources (MDAR) is accepting applications and resumes for the position of Agricultural Marketing Resource Coordinator. The Agricultural Marketing Resource Coordinator reports to the Director of the Division of Agricultural Markets and supports the enhancement of marketing strategies through the implementation of marketing and promotional initiatives and collaboration with stakeholders.

  A cover letter and resume must be submitted as part of the application process and attached "as relevant" to the requisition.

  Duties:

  • Administer Buy Local Projects including the development of Requests for Responses (RFR), execution of contracts and contract management throughout the fiscal year.

  • Work with stakeholders to support greater use and visibility of the MassGrown...Fresher brand. Attend meetings and conferences of various commodity and farm organizations to stay abreast of marketing trends and techniques and to consult with organization members.

  • Research and assemble data to support planning, organizing, and development activities associated with new or existing marketing systems.

  • Recommend or assist in preparing policies and procedures related to agricultural marketing programs. Respond to questions or inquiries concerning marketing information or programs through written correspondence or personal contacts.

  • Responsible for the coordination and approval of Agricultural Event Certifications for wine sales at farmers' markets. Develop and update procedures for program effectiveness, review and make recommendations for application approvals. Consult with manager and legal office in review of applications, as needed, and communicate department approvals to applicants while maintaining program database and files.

  • Dairy Tax Credit Program, coordinate with the Fiscal Office to annually administer the Dairy Tax Credit to dairy farmers. Maintain annual updates to the dairy tax credit website, the dairy tax credit application, and mailing list. Respond to dairy farmer inquiries and requests for assistance. Assist the Fiscal Office with maintaining the Dairy Tax Credit database regarding monthly production reports or other tasks, as necessary.

  • Help and support Division staff with MDAR booth set-up/staffing at industry and consumer events. Assist with special projects as needed.

  • Assist in the development of new initiatives as well as the evaluation of current programing to further implement the goals and objectives of the Division as well as the Department.

  MINIMUM ENTRANCE REQUIREMENTS: Applicants must have at least (A) three years of full time, or equivalent part-time, professional, administrative or managerial experience in business administration, business management or public administration the major duties of which involved program management, program administration, program coordination, program planning and/or program analysis, or (B) any equivalent combination of the required experience and the substitutions below.

  Substitutions:

  I. A Bachelor's degree with a major in business administration, business management or public administration may be substituted for a maximum of two years of the-required experience.

  II. A Graduate degree with a major in business administration, business management or public administration may be substituted for the required experience.

  III. A Bachelor's or higher degree with a major other than in business administration, business management or public administration may be substituted for a maximum of one year of the required experience.

  Education toward such a degree will be prorated on the basis of the proportion of the requirements actually completed.
